ORANGE PARK, Fla. (AP) — The family of slain 7-year-old Somer Thompson is preparing to lay the child to rest, a week after she vanished in north Florida on her way home from school. A viewing is scheduled in the Jacksonville suburb of Orange Park tonight, followed by a funeral tomorrow morning. After the final services, mourners plan to launch thousands of purple balloons.

WASHINGTON (AP) — Health and Human Services Secretary Kathleen Sebelius says it appears the estimates from the swine flu vaccine manufacturers were a bit too optimistic. She tells the morning network news programs that there are some delays in getting the supplies where they're needed, but that there will be enough to go around eventually.

WASHINGTON (AP) — Extending jobless benefits to those who are still out of work will be one focus of Senate Democrats this week. The bill would extend expiring benefits for 14 weeks in all states and an extra six weeks in states where unemployment is above 8 1/2 percent. Republicans have blocked unanimous consent and Democrats now say they're open to GOP amendments.

KABUL (AP) — Helicopter crashes in Afghanistan, including a midair collision, have killed 14 Americans, including three civilians. In the capital, Kabul, it's a second day of demonstrations by university students. They're protesting the alleged desecration of the Muslim holy book by U.S. troops. Both U.S. and Afghan authorities have denied that any desecration took place.

WASHINGTON (AP) — President Barack Obama meets with his national security team to discuss Afghanistan later today. It's his sixth major Afghanistan conference in the White House Situation Room. Later, Obama travels to Jacksonville Naval Air Station in Florida to visit with troops.
